《一机双站:探究在同一服务器上部署两套WordPress的可行性与策略》
结论:在同一个服务器上部署两套WordPress系统是完全可行的,但这需要深思熟虑的规划和实施,以确保资源的有效分配,避免潜在的冲突,并维持网站的稳定性和性能。这种做法可以节省成本,提高效率,但也可能带来一些挑战,如数据隔离、性能管理、安全问题等。因此,理解其优缺点并采取适当的策略是至关重要的。
正文:
在数字化时代,WordPress作为全球最受欢迎的内容管理系统,其灵活和强大的功能吸引了无数用户。对于那些拥有多个网站或希望在单一服务器上测试不同版本WordPress的用户来说,一个自然的问题就出现了:能否在同一台服务器上部署两套WordPress系统?
首先,从技术角度来看,这完全是可能的。通过使用子目录或子域名,我们可以轻松地在同一个服务器上设置两个独立的WordPress实例。例如,一个可以放在根目录,另一个则可以放在如“/site2/”这样的子目录下。每个站点都有自己独立的数据库和配置文件,理论上不会相互干扰。
然而,实际操作中,我们需要考虑的远不止这些。首要问题便是资源分配。同一服务器上的两个WordPress站点会共享服务器资源,如CPU、内存和磁盘空间。如果两个站点的流量都很大,可能会导致资源紧张,影响到网站的加载速度和用户体验。因此,需要定期监控和调整资源分配,以保证两者的平稳运行。
其次,数据隔离是一个不容忽视的问题。尽管每个WordPress都有自己的数据库,但如果配置不当,可能会出现数据冲突。例如,插件或主题的更新可能会影响到另一个站点。因此,必须确保每个站点的配置文件(如wp-config.php)都是独立的,并且避免使用可能导致全局影响的全局变量。
再次,安全性也是一个挑战。一旦一个站点受到攻击,可能会波及到另一个。因此,每个站点都需要独立的安全措施,如定期更新、使用强密码、安装防火墙等。
最后,维护和管理的复杂性也会增加。更新、备份、故障排查等任务都需要考虑到两个站点,这无疑增加了工作量。
总的来说,尽管在同一服务器上部署两套WordPress有其复杂性,但通过精心规划、合理配置和谨慎管理,可以实现这一目标。对于小型项目或者预算有限的用户,这种方式可以有效地降低成本。然而,对于大型或高流量的网站,可能需要考虑更强大的服务器解决方案,以确保性能和稳定性。无论选择哪种方式,理解并应对可能出现的问题是成功的关键。
CDNK博客